Transaction 50a736ed51401d6edc71a611c909c52e137923f62abaf37932a419638f572b33
1 Input
2 Outputs
- 50a736ed51401d6edc71a611c909c52e137923f62abaf37932a419638f572b33:0
- 50a736ed51401d6edc71a611c909c52e137923f62abaf37932a419638f572b33:1
value 2772531
address 1BMKZUwvTpurARqohvtBQ93uVrD3Zywgs4
value 18680000
address 1GKXLnX3u59AMeaG4AFiT7E5APUARZJJoF